Core Viewpoint - OpenAI has signed a significant cloud computing partnership with Amazon, valued at $38 billion, marking a shift in its cloud service strategy away from Microsoft [10][60]. Group 1: OpenAI and Amazon Partnership - OpenAI has entered into a $38 billion strategic partnership with Amazon Web Services (AWS), which is considered one of the largest cloud service contracts in history [10][11]. - This partnership allows OpenAI to access AWS's extensive computing resources, including tens of thousands of the latest NVIDIA GPUs and millions of CPUs [17][20]. - OpenAI plans to fully utilize AWS's computing resources immediately and aims to complete the deployment by the end of 2026, with additional capacity reserved for 2027 and beyond [22][23]. Group 2: Financial Implications - Following the announcement of the partnership, Amazon's stock price surged over 5%, adding nearly $140 billion to its market capitalization [11]. - OpenAI's recent financial struggles were highlighted, with a reported loss of $11.5 billion in the previous quarter, raising questions about its financial sustainability [5][60]. - OpenAI's ambitious plan includes a $1.4 trillion investment in building a computing infrastructure of approximately 30 gigawatts, which is equivalent to the output of 30 nuclear power plants [28][29]. Group 3: Shift from Microsoft - OpenAI has restructured its relationship with Microsoft, ending a nearly six-year exclusive cloud service agreement, which previously required all of OpenAI's operations to rely on Azure [35][36]. - The new agreement allows OpenAI to procure cloud resources from multiple providers, including AWS, without needing Microsoft's approval [46][48]. - Despite losing exclusive rights, Microsoft remains a significant partner, with OpenAI committing to purchase approximately $250 billion worth of Azure services [60]. Group 4: Competitive Landscape - The partnership with AWS is seen as a strategic move for Amazon, which has been perceived as lagging in AI development compared to competitors like Microsoft and Google [64][66]. - Amazon's founder, Jeff Bezos, has been actively involved in pushing for AI partnerships, indicating a strong desire to enhance AWS's position in the AI market [70][72]. - OpenAI's recent contracts, including the $38 billion deal with AWS and a reported $300 billion contract with Oracle, suggest a trend of significant financial commitments in the AI sector [61][62].

Business Overview - Haoyun Technology, established on March 8, 2001, and listed on April 24, 2015, specializes in financial security system design, integration, and operation services, along with related software and hardware products [1]. - The company's main revenue sources include low-code platform and IoT platform construction and solutions (95.45%), IoT device and software sales (3.51%), and leasing income (1.05%) [1]. Core Insights - The smart examination room is transforming traditional examination models towards intelligent, automated, and fair systems, leveraging technologies like AI, big data, and cloud computing to enhance the integrity, security, and efficiency of the examination process [1][11] - The smart examination room market is rapidly growing globally, with significant advancements in Asia, particularly in China, where the market size is projected to increase from 1.668 billion yuan in 2017 to 4.575 billion yuan in 2024, reflecting a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 11.86% [1][11] - The increasing number of candidates for national examinations, such as the college entrance examination, is driving the demand for smart examination solutions, which are essential for improving examination governance and maintaining educational fairness [1][9] Industry Overview - The smart examination room utilizes advanced technologies such as image processing, facial recognition, voice analysis, and behavior analysis to create a comprehensive monitoring system that identifies and alerts against cheating behaviors throughout the examination process [4] - The construction of smart examination rooms involves upgrading existing computer examination facilities with intelligent monitoring systems and robots, enhancing the anti-cheating capabilities and service efficiency of the examination system [4] Market Dynamics - The smart examination room industry is characterized by a multi-faceted ecosystem involving traditional educational examination institutions, technology innovation companies, and research institutions, all contributing to the development and implementation of smart examination solutions [11] - Key players in the smart examination room market include companies like Tuowei Information, Jiafa Education, and Keda Xunfei, which provide comprehensive solutions encompassing intelligent monitoring, identity verification, and cheating prevention [12][11] Industry Challenges - The smart examination room industry faces several challenges, including technological bottlenecks in AI applications for monitoring and automated scoring, as well as data security and privacy concerns related to the handling of personal information and examination data [15][16] - High construction and operational costs pose a barrier for smaller examination institutions, necessitating strategies to reduce expenses while maintaining quality and effectiveness [17] Future Trends - The future of the smart examination room industry is expected to see deeper integration of edge computing and IoT technologies, enhancing device interconnectivity and data processing capabilities [20] - There will be a shift towards personalized services in smart examination systems, allowing for tailored examination environments based on individual candidate profiles [21] - The application scenarios for smart examination rooms are anticipated to expand beyond traditional education to include vocational skills certification and corporate talent assessment, with advancements in remote monitoring technologies supporting international examination standards [22]
